Abstract
A storage device for flat recording media, e.g. compact discs, is disclosed. The device comprises a housing and a slider member having a base portion and front wall that covers the open front face of the housing when the slider member is inserted. A lifting element, which is transported out of the housing by means of the slider member, is provided for supporting the recording media in a position for easy insertion and removal.
